With this expansion, the pharmacy network has grown from an initial 85 sites to 126 with further locations to open in the near future. The addition of a number of other independent sites from Florida to Alaska allows the network to assure broad availability of unit-dose radiopharmaceuticals to a majority of the hospitals and clinics in the US which offer nuclear medicine services. These specialized pharmacies utilize specially trained Pharmacists and technologists to prepare, quality check and dispense important diagnostic and therapeutic doses for specific patients in the local imaging centers. The use of these specialists relieves the user hospitals and clinics from having to employ expensive staff, and greatly reduces the costs of radiopharmaceuticals by preventing unnecessary spoilage spoilage decomposition; said of meat, milk, animal feeds especially ensilage. and waste of the short-lived materials. It also allows for doses prepared under the supervision of highly trained and motivated experts that are not readily available at local facilities. As a part of the comprehensive assessment of the marketplace, Medi-Physics has recently settled all existing disputes with Syncor International Corporation, and as a part of this settlement, it has been determined that Medi-Physics will sell CeretecR to Syncor under a 1994 consignment agreement. As a result of this agreement, Syncor will distribute Ceretec, on a non-exclusive basis, for a two year period through its pharmacy network. Medi-Physics proprietary product Ceretec, is a radiopharmaceutical which is used for brain imaging and white blood cell labeling.
